Sign upAn AI-based approach for the realization of renewable energy projects and nanogrids on most buildings
vadiMAP means "moving on to green with My Advanced Power". The purpose of the vadiMAP solution is to get the optimal renewable energy system depending on buildings' geographic, energy and operational context. Based on a user-friendly online platform, vadiMAP allows building owners to save energy costs, gain autonomy and reach carbon neutrality. The process starts with a comprehensive online questionnaire to collect the data needed to deliver a one-of-a-kind prescription report to enable smart decision-making. The turnkey process continues until the optimal renewable energy system is turned on with the expected results. For building owners and operators, vadiMAP makes it possible to create an energy transition plan for a fraction of the time and costs of the mainstream alternatives.
vadiMAP by vadimUS
Implemented by City of Shawinigan in Shawinigan (Canada) in 2023
The municipality of Shawinigan called upon vadimUS to study the potential of its Garage Municipal in 2021. After a thorough analysis of the client’s needs, geographical location, and market data, a tailored nanogrid was suggested. The project which is still in development and will be finalized in 2023, consists of a 24 kW solar photovoltaic panel, a battery energy system storage with a 30 kW power and a 91 kWh capacity, as well as a 280 m2 of solar thermal collectors.
Result
Estimated future project impact is 4h of backup power, -23 k+ m3 natural gas consumption & -46 t co2eq
